Aditya Vikram Birla – Industrialist from the prestigious Birla family of Rajasthan

Aditya Vikram Birla (1943 – 1995) was an industrialist and businessman belonging to Birla family, traditionally associated with business. He was one of the early members from his family who tried with diversifying products and succeeded in this field. He also set up many business organizations and factories outside India, and was one of the early Indian industrialists to do so. He was only 51 when he passed away after diagnosed with prostrate cancer, leaving behind the legacy to his 28 year old less-experienced son Kumar Mangalam Birla, who later expanded the group of companies named as Aditya Birla Group, and the now the group enjoys the third-position in private sector conglomerate in India with a turnover of 41 billion US dollars in 2015.

Aditya Vikram Birla was born in Kolkata in 1943 to industrialists Basant Kumar Birla and Sarala Birla. His grandfather Ghanshyam Das Birla was also a businessman with close association with Mahatma Gandhi. Gandhi was staying in Birla’s house for the last three months before he was assassinated. Aditya spent his younger days in Kolkata where he completed his studies. Later he moved abroad and studied chemical engineering at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ology, after which he returned to India in 1965 and joined family business. Initially he was associated with textiles sector.

In Kolkata he successfully established Eastern Spinning Mills, after which he decided to diversify his business. He moved to oil business, which was profitable. In 3 decades of his business career, he expanded Birla business family to other countries, and successfully ventured into new sectors also. Through his efforts he was able to put Birla group of industries in India’s corporate map, and after his death in 1995 his son Kumar Mangalam Birla took the organization to new heights. Aditya’s wife Rajashree Birla was a philanthropist and a recipient of Padma Bhushan, and the couple had one son and one daughter.

Aditya Vikram Birla – Some interesting and less-known facts

1. He belongs to the 4th generation of Birla business empire. The family firm was initially known as Baldeodas Jugalkishore, which was renamed as Birla Brothers Limited in the year 1918. 

2. His father outlived him for nearly 25 years. While Aditya passed away in 1995 in his middle ages, his father died in 2019 aged 98.

3. He was one of the first Indian industrialists to set up factories in South East Asia, Philippines and Egypt.

4. His grandchildren are not associated with his business empire. Among the three kids of Kumar Mangalam Birla, Ananya Birla is a pop singer while Aryaman Birla is a young cricketer.

5. Brajlal Biyani, independent activist is his maternal grandfather.

6. Rameswar Das Birla, Baldeo Das Birla, Krishna Kumar Birla, Ganga Prasad Birla, Chandrakant Birla and Yasovardhan Birla are some other prominent figures of Birla family belonging to different generations. Most of them were associated with business and well-known industrialists.

7. Well-known industrialist Krishna Kumar Birla was his paternal uncle. 

8. His first cousin Shobhana Bhartia (daughter of Krishna Kumar Birla) is perhaps the most prominent female member of Birla family (Rajashree Birla and Sarla Birla being daughter-in-laws). She is the Chairperson and Editorial Director of the Hindustan Times Group, inherited from her father.
